Mini360 DC-DC Buck Converter Module — 2A, Adjustable 1V–17V Step-Down, 2pcs

The Mini360 is an ultra-compact synchronous DC-DC step-down (buck) converter module based on the MP2307 IC, providing adjustable output voltage from 1V to 17V at up to 2A continuous current from an input of 4.75V to 23V. The miniature footprint (17×11mm) makes it ideal for space-constrained applications including RC aircraft, FPV drones, Arduino power regulation, and embedded system power supply design. Output voltage is set by a small onboard trimmer potentiometer. Supplied as a 2-piece pack.

Technical Specifications

Parameter Value
IC MP2307 synchronous buck converter
Input Voltage 4.75V – 23V DC
Output Voltage 1V – 17V DC (adjustable via trimmer)
Output Current 2A continuous (3A peak)
Switching Frequency 340kHz
Efficiency Up to 96%
Output Ripple <30mV (typ.)
Operating Temperature −40°C to +85°C
PCB Size 17 × 11mm
Pack Quantity 2pcs
Certification RoHS

Input / Output Voltage Compatibility

Input Voltage Output Range Typical Use
5V USB 1V – 4.5V 3.3V logic supply from USB power
7.4V (2S LiPo) 1V – 6.5V 5V Arduino / servo supply from 2S LiPo
11.1V (3S LiPo) 1V – 10V 5V / 3.3V from 3S LiPo for FPV electronics
12V 1V – 11V 5V / 3.3V from 12V automotive or PSU
12–23V 1V – 17V Adjustable bench supply, LED driver

How to Adjust Output Voltage

  • Connect input voltage (4.75–23V) to VIN+ and GND
  • Connect a multimeter to VOUT+ and GND
  • Use a small flathead screwdriver to turn the trimmer potentiometer clockwise to increase output voltage, counter-clockwise to decrease
  • Set to desired output voltage before connecting the load
  • Do not exceed 17V output or 2A continuous load current

FAQ

Q: Can the Mini360 output more than the input voltage?
A: No. This is a step-down (buck) converter only — output voltage must always be lower than input voltage. For step-up (boost) conversion, use an MT3608 or XL6009 boost converter module.

Q: Does the Mini360 need a heatsink?
A: At loads below 1A, no heatsink is required. At 1.5–2A continuous load, the module will run warm — ensure adequate airflow. A small heatsink on the MP2307 IC is recommended for sustained 2A operation in enclosed spaces.
